Bethel High School Navy JROTC conducted Basic Leadership Training at Camp Niantic

Bethel High School Navy JROTC conducted Basic Leadership Training 2017 (BLT) at Camp Niantic in Niantic, CT from Sept. 28th to Oct. 1st.

Bethel Superintendent of Schools, Christine Carver announced in today's newsletter to parents, "It was a total success. There were 258 cadets in attendance from 6 schools, including 118 Bethel cadets."

According to Carver, cadets Patrick Joyce, Donovan Eaton, Olivia McGarry and Jack Morris planned, managed and led all of the major events. 

"Watching them work was like watching active duty junior officers make the mission happen. Please join me in congratulating the honor cadets who were selected by their drill instructors as the most motivated and best performers during the tough 4-day training," said Carver.

Congratulations to Katrina Geslein, Victor Pinheiro, Luca Cazzaniga, Rachel Nelson, and Autumn Lahood.
